WSNs中基于数字水印的克隆攻击检测与反制策略
148 浏览量
更新于2024-08-29
收藏 466KB PDF 举报
"本文提出了一种针对无线传感器网络(WSNs)中节点克隆攻击的检测方案,利用数字水印技术和统计方法。该方案通过在数据采样间隔中嵌入可逆的水印来防止攻击者复制节点。水印的嵌入与提取过程确保了数据的完整性和网络的安全性。在集群头节点中,水印被重建并进行统计分析,以检测潜在的克隆攻击。实验结果显示,该方法具有较高的检测效率和准确性。"
在无线传感器网络中,由于设备成本低且常常部署在难以监控的环境中,节点容易受到物理攻击,如节点克隆攻击。攻击者可能捕获节点,复制其身份并部署克隆节点,干扰网络正常运行。为了应对这一威胁,研究者提出了基于数字水印的防御策略。数字水印是一种在数据中嵌入隐藏信息的技术,用于证明数据所有权或验证数据完整性。在这个方案中,水印不是简单地附加到数据上,而是根据数据采样时间动态计算生成,增强了其不可篡改性和隐蔽性。
具体实施过程中,每个数据采样周期都会生成一个新的水印,然后将其嵌入到传感器节点发送的数据包中。这些数据包随后在簇内传播,簇头节点负责收集和重建这些水印。通过统计分析重建的水印特征,可以检测出是否存在异常模式,即可能的克隆节点。这种方法的优势在于,即使节点被复制,克隆节点也无法完美复制原节点的水印序列,从而暴露出其存在。
此外,该方案设计为可逆,意味着在数据处理和传输后,水印能够被准确无损地提取出来,不影响原始数据的使用。这在资源有限的传感器网络中尤为重要,因为它避免了额外的计算和存储开销。
性能分析和模拟实验进一步证实了该方法的有效性。通过对比不同攻击条件下的检测结果,该方案表现出良好的鲁棒性,能够有效检测并定位克隆攻击,提高了WSNs的安全性。
总结起来,"无线传感器网络中基于数字水印的节点克隆攻击检测方案"是一种创新的防护机制,它结合了数字水印和统计分析,为WSNs提供了对克隆攻击的防御手段。未来的研究可能会进一步优化水印算法,提高检测精度,同时减少对传感器节点资源的消耗。
2010-01-20 上传
2023-10-16 上传
2021-05-26 上传
2023-06-12 上传
2023-05-28 上传
2023-07-02 上传
2023-05-13 上传
2023-04-02 上传
2023-05-13 上传
weixin_38705640
- 粉丝: 8
- 资源: 953
最新资源
- 深入浅出:自定义 Grunt 任务的实践指南
- 网络物理突变工具的多点路径规划实现与分析
- multifeed: 实现多作者间的超核心共享与同步技术
- C++商品交易系统实习项目详细要求
- macOS系统Python模块whl包安装教程
- 掌握fullstackJS:构建React框架与快速开发应用
- React-Purify: 实现React组件纯净方法的工具介绍
- deck.js:构建现代HTML演示的JavaScript库
- nunn:现代C++17实现的机器学习库开源项目
- Python安装包 Acquisition-4.12-cp35-cp35m-win_amd64.whl.zip 使用说明
- Amaranthus-tuberculatus基因组分析脚本集
- Ubuntu 12.04下Realtek RTL8821AE驱动的向后移植指南
- 掌握Jest环境下的最新jsdom功能
- CAGI Toolkit:开源Asterisk PBX的AGI应用开发
- MyDropDemo: 体验QGraphicsView的拖放功能
- 远程FPGA平台上的Quartus II17.1 LCD色块闪烁现象解析